A circle is graphed with its center on the origin.The area of the circle is 49 square units.What are the coordinates of the x-in

tercepts of the graph? Round to the nearest tenth
Mathematics
1 answer:
neonofarm [45]3 years ago
3 0

Answer:

3.95 and -3.95

Step-by-step explanation:

To graph a circle you can use the formula or (x – h)^2 + (y – k)^2 = r^2. So substituting in the given, we get x^2+y^2=49/pi. The x intercept is when y=0. So x^2=49/pi and so

x = sqrt(49/pi) and rounding to the nearest tenth, we get 3.95 and -3.95 because it isn’t a principal square root.

The perimeter of a rectangle is 150 cm. the length is 4 cm greater than the width find the width and length
Fudgin [204]

Let's call the width of our rectangle w and the length l. We can say l = w + 4, since the length is equal to 4 cm greater than the width.


Also remember that the perimeter of a rectangle is the sum of two times the width and two times the length, or P = 2l + 2w. To solve this problem, we can substitute in the information we know, as shown below:

150 = 2(w + 4) + 2w

150 = 4w + 8

142 = 4w

w = \frac{71}{2}


Now, we can substitute in the width we found into the formula for length, which is l = w + 4:

l = \frac{71}{2} + 4

l = \frac{79}{2}


The width of our rectangle is \boxed{\frac{71}{2} \,\, \textrm{cm}} cm and the length of our rectangle is \boxed{\frac{79}{2} \,\, \textrm{cm}}
